Scope1.1 This guide covers methods for determining and evalu-ating causes of water leakage of exterior walls. For thispurpose, water penetration is considered leakage, and thereforeproblematic, if it exceeds the planned resistance or temporaryretention and drainage capacity of the wall, is causing or islikely to cause premature deterioration of a building or itscontents, or is adversely affecting the performance of othercomponents. A wall is considered a system including itsexterior and interior f i nishes, fenestration, structuralcomponents, and components for maintaining the buildinginterior environment.1.2 Investigative techniques discussed may be intrusive,disruptive, or destructive. It is the responsibility of the inves-tigator to establish the limitations of use, to anticipate andadvise of the destructive nature of some procedures, and toplan for patching and selective reconstruction as necessary.1.3 The values stated in SI units are to be regarded asstandard.
